You've already forked VptPassiveAdapter
tracer层级问题
This commit is contained in:
@ -14,12 +14,14 @@ import (
|
||||
)
|
||||
|
||||
func UploadTaskFile(ctx context.Context, task dto.Task, file dto.FileObject) error {
|
||||
url, err := QueryUploadUrlForTask(ctx, task.TaskID)
|
||||
subCtx, span := tracer.Start(ctx, "UploadTaskFile")
|
||||
defer span.End()
|
||||
url, err := QueryUploadUrlForTask(subCtx, task.TaskID)
|
||||
if err != nil {
|
||||
return err
|
||||
}
|
||||
log.Printf("开始上传文件, URL:【%s】\n", url)
|
||||
if err := OssUpload(ctx, url, file.URL); err != nil {
|
||||
if err := OssUpload(subCtx, url, file.URL); err != nil {
|
||||
return err
|
||||
}
|
||||
return nil
|
||||
|
Reference in New Issue
Block a user